  • Correcting Form 1094-C and 1095-C Errors Although the deadlines for employers to file and furnish their 2017 Forms 1094-C & 1095-C have passed, employers should confirm the accuracy of these forms and correct any errors on them soon to avoid noncompliance penalties. For more information on correcting errors, see the 2017 Instructions for Forms 1094-C and 1095-C.
  • 2019 Cost-Sharing Limits for Most Group Health Plans Released: A new rule from the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) addresses, among other things, the requirement under the Affordable Care Act that non-grandfathered group health plans limit annual out-of-pocket cost-sharing for coverage of essential health benefits under the plan. Under the rule, these out-of-pocket expenses may not exceed $7,900 for self-only coverage or $15,800 for family coverage in 2019.
